Canada, Peru Sign MOU to Strengthen Critical Minerals Cooperation

Canada and Peru have signed a Memorandum of Understanding (MOU) to boost collaboration on critical minerals and sustainable mining, the federal government announced Friday.

The agreement, signed by Canada’s Ambassador to Peru Jean-Dominique Ieraci on behalf of Tim Hodgson, and Peru’s Minister of Energy and Mines Angelo Victorino Alfaro Lombardi, aims to advance bilateral investment, drive technological solutions for traceability and decarbonization, improve regulatory frameworks, and promote environmental and social best practices.

“This Memorandum of Understanding reflects the strength of Canada and Peru’s bilateral trade relationship and underscores our shared commitment to deepening co-operation in the mining sector,” Ieraci said. “Together, we are fostering innovation, promoting responsible resource development and building the skilled workforce needed for a low-carbon future.”

Hodgson highlighted Canada’s mineral resources and mining expertise as key drivers for trade and economic growth. “Canada has what the world wants,” he said. “This MOU with Peru, our second-largest bilateral merchandise trading partner in South and Central America, will strengthen our mining relationship and generate new opportunities for Canadian exports and investment.”

Since summer 2025, Canada has signed 21 bilateral collaboration frameworks on mining and critical minerals and led the creation of the G7 Critical Minerals Production Alliance, which has mobilized $18.5 billion in capital for mining projects in under six months.

The new agreement with Peru is expected to enhance Canada’s role as a major mining investor, expand exports of Canadian mining equipment, technology and services, and help build secure, diversified and sustainable critical mineral supply chains.
